Detection and Repair of Water Leakage in Restroom


Water leak in washroom frequently results from plumbing and pipe mistakes. There are a number of types of washroom leakages. You may require a fundamental knowledge of these leakage types to identify the water leak in bathroom. Below are the common washroom leaks and also repair pointers:

Clogged Bathroom Sinks


Occasionally, the water leak in restroom arises from sink obstructions. This is frequently a problem to house owners and also might be undesirable. Obstructions might result from the buildup of soap scum, hair particles, or particles that obstruct the drainpipe. It is very easy to take care of blockages, as well as you may not need specialist abilities.

What to Do


You can use a drainpipe snake to remove the debris in the drainpipe and allow the stationary water circulation. Drain cleansers are also offered in stores as well as are very easy to make use of.

Commode Leaks


Often, water leakages from the commode and also swimming pools around the bathroom base. It is an eye sore in the washroom as well as requires timely attention. In some cases, it results from a loose link in between the storage tank as well as the toilet. This triggers water to drip from the tank to the floor. It may additionally result from splits in the toilet dish or a defective shut-off shutoff.

What to Do


If there hang bolts between the tank as well as bathroom, you just require to tighten them. Occasionally you might require to reapply wax on the gasket or call in a restroom leakage expert to replace worn or broken components.

Dash Leaks


These commonly result from water spilling on the washroom flooring from the bathtub. It damages the bathroom floor and also might trigger rot to wooden floors and also washroom doors.

What to Do


This bathroom leak is the easiest to take care of. You only require to change the drapes or recaulk the bathtub or shower. You might need to transform these to stop further damages if the leak has actually damaged the shower room flooring or door. The good news is that you can include a pipes expert to help with the restroom repair work.

Water Leaking in the Bathroom Wall


A GUIDE TO FINDING LEAKS IN BATHROOM WALLS


  • Paint or Wallpaper Peeling: This sign is easily spotted, so it cannot be missed. A leak in the wall can lead to wallpaper that separates along seams or paint that bubbles or flakes off the walls.


  • Musty Smells: The damp flooring and plaster inside the wall grow an odor similar to wet cardboard as water slowly drips from a leaky pipe inside the wall. You can find leaks hidden beneath a musty odor.


  • Growing Stains: The interior of a wall affected by a leaky pipe sometimes becomes infested with mold. Often, your indicator of a hidden plumbing problem is a growing strain on otherwise clean plaster.


  • Structural Damage: Do not overlook constant moisture inside the walls of bathrooms when ceilings or floors become structurally compromised. Water-damaged walls can damage adjacent surfaces and stain flooring and ceilings.


  • Unusual Discoloration: The wet spots may eventually dry when a leak penetrates deeper inside a wall. The stains they leave behind are paler than the adjacent paint or surface.


  • Dripping Sound: It is common to hear dripping sounds inside walls when water runs down them. A squeaking noise can be heard while turning off a valve in a sink, bathtub, or shower. When flushing the toilet, you may also hear this noise.


  • A GUIDE TO REPAIRING WATER LEAKAGE




  • Verify The Wall Leak: Shut down your main water supply and note the reading on your water meter. If the meter reading rises after a few hours, the leak is inside the house. In the absence of any changes, the leak may be the result of clogged gutters or drains.


  • Turn off the water: You can turn off the water after you confirm the leak is within the walls. If you’re beginning repairs, drain as much water from the pipes as possible.


  • Find & Fix The Leakage: Locate the wettest area on the wall with a moisture meter or infrared camera. Patch kits can stop the leak, but the fix might only be short-term. In the next few days, double-check the area to ensure the leak is no longer present.


  • Removing mold and cleaning all surfaces: Dish soap and warm water should be used to clean affected areas. Bleach and water are recommended for disinfecting nonporous surfaces. Fan and dehumidifier running will speed up drying time. Remove mold growth immediately from walls, ceilings, and other surfaces.
